Web12 mei 2024 · WATERLOO, Iowa (AP) — An immigrant from Congo who worked at the Tyson Foods pork processing plant in Waterloo has died of the coronavirus, the company confirmed Tuesday. The Congoloese community in Waterloo has been mourning the death of Axel Kabeya, which several members announced Sunday on social media.
